Dorothy Prowell is a scholar working on Genetics,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Insect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Dorothy Prowell has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 983 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Genetics, 9 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and 7 papers in Insect Science. Recurrent topics in Dorothy Prowell's work include Plant and animal studies (6 papers), Lepidoptera: Biology and Taxonomy (6 papers) and Genetic diversity and population structure (4 papers). Dorothy Prowell is often cited by papers focused on Plant and animal studies (6 papers), Lepidoptera: Biology and Taxonomy (6 papers) and Genetic diversity and population structure (4 papers). Dorothy Prowell collaborates with scholars based in United States, France and Australia. Dorothy Prowell's co-authors include J. L. Bossart, Margaret McMichael, Johanne Silvain, Debra Murray, Andrew Mitchell, Christopher E. Carlton, Gaël J. Kergoat, Anne‐Laure Clamens, Pascaline Dumas and Bruno P. Le Rü and has published in prestigious journals such as Trends in Ecology & Evolution, Molecular Phylogenetics and Evolution and Annals of the Entomological Society of America.
